Installation via Windows emulators on Android
The most reliable way to plunge into the world of tricks is to install a full-fledged operating system emulator. apps like Winlator or Mobox allow you to run old games of the era Windows XP i Windows 7 directly on the smartphone processor. This method requires more powerful hardware, but gives a better experience.
The setup process begins by downloading the system image and the emulator itself. After installation, you need to create a container by selecting the appropriate graphics drivers Turnip or Box64. It is these components that are responsible for translating processor instructions, allowing the game to think that it is running on a regular computer.

It is important to understand that emulation consumes a significant amount of resources. The device may become hot and the battery may drain faster than usual. It is recommended to close all background applications before starting Neighbours from Hellto free up RAM.

System requirements and optimization
Running a PC game on a phone places high demands on the hardware. To play comfortably through the emulator, you will need a device with a processor of at least Snapdragon 730 or an equivalent from MediaTek. The amount of RAM should be a minimum 4 GBalthough 6-8 GB is recommended.
The graphics accelerator plays a key role. Chips Adreno traditionally show better compatibility with emulators thanks to open drivers. Owners of smartphones with graphics Mali may encounter image artifacts or low FPS.

To improve performance, you can reduce the rendering resolution in the emulator settings. Disabling shadows and anti-aliasing will also help achieve a stable 30-60 fps. Do not forget to monitor the temperature of the device to avoid throttling.
The performance of the emulator is 80% dependent on the power of the processor and the quality of graphics drivers, and not on the version of the operating system.
Setting up touch screen controls
The original game was designed for mouse and keyboard control, so porting it to a touchscreen requires careful setup. Most emulators have a built-in screen button editor that allows you to assign actions to specific areas of the display.
You need to create a virtual cursor that will move around the screen using a joystick or swipe. Action buttons (pick up item, use, walk) should be located in a comfortable area for the thumb. This is critical for passing levels where reaction speed is required.
Some emulators support a function Mouse Capturethat hides the cursor and allows you to control it directly by touch. This may be unusual, but it gives greater accuracy when interacting with small objects in your neighbor's inventory.

Solving common problems and bugs
Even if all requirements are met, users may encounter technical problems. A black screen at startup often indicates that the graphics driver was incorrectly selected in the emulator settings. Try switching between DXVK and standard OpenGL modes.
No sound is a common problem associated with audio driver conflicts. In the emulator settings, try changing the sample rate or disabling hardware audio acceleration. Sometimes simply restarting the container helps.

If the game crashes at a certain point, the problem may be in a specific level script. Try loading a previous save or using cheat codes to skip the problematic scene. The community of players often shares fixes for such situations on forums.
What to do if the game is slow?
Try lowering the rendering resolution to 800x600, turning off sounds and closing all background applications. Also make sure that the phone does not overheat.

Why does the game run slowly on a powerful phone?
The problem may be in optimizing the emulator for your specific processor. Try changing graphics settings, drivers, or emulator version. Not all chips cope equally well with emulating x86 instructions.
Do you need Internet to play the game after installation?
No, after installing the game and the emulator, the Internet is not required. The game is completely offline if you do not use the online functions of the emulator or cloud saves.
